Price sounds right for small quantities, bag or 2. I prefer the Sodium Hydroxide beads over flakes, just my personal preference. Basically I think they are uniform in strength. I would buy from your nearest supplier to save on freight. Look around your area and you might find someone local. If you are going to make your own chemicals, order some surfactant (gelling agent) too. That will help the chemical cling to the surface you are cleaning. Oxalic acid, I believe comes in a crystal form sort of like sugar, at least what I have did. Don't mix it untill you are ready to use. I haven't used any citric acid before.
